Joe Hergert
Head Coach 1991-1993

Coach Hergert was the eighth Head Football Coach at Spruce Creek serving from 1991-1993. 

He played football at Mainland High School.  At the University of Florida , he played center.  One of Coach Hergert's teammates at Mainland in the 1950's was former Creek Head Coach Ramey.  Coach Hergert was drafted by the Greeen Bay Packers in 1959.  He played for two years (19 games) with the Buffalo Bills as their starting linebacker and placekicker.   In 1961-62 with Buffalo, Joe Hergert had 34 tackles, 2 forced fumbles and 1 fumble recovery, 2 interceptions and kicked 8 field goals.

As head coach at Mainland Jr. High School, he won two County Championships in the  late 1960's.  Coach Hergert went to Colorado where he served 11 years as Head Coach of the Salida High Schooland won two State Championships in the  1970's.  Salida High School went to the playoffs nine times while Coach Hergert was there. Coach Hergert served as Offensive Coordinator at Mainland in 1990 where the team went 10-1.

Prior to coming to Spruce Creek, Coach Hergert's record was: 99 wins, 32 losses.

In 1993, the Hawks finished their regular season 6-4 with a four-way tie for second in Class 5A District 4 competition with Oviedo, DeLand and Lake Howell.  In a  one quarter game followed by two "Kansas tie-breaker"  overtimes , Creek came up short when Oviedo scored on a two point conversion.   Oviedo went on to the State playoffs as District Runner-up.

The Hawks record  from 1991-1993 was 9- 21.
